Job Description

SMART Advocacy breaks down the goal of an organization into actionable steps and shows how to convince the people with power that taking necessary actions will achieve the organizational goals. The process delivers an evidence-driven strategy that leaders can takeforward confidently. The consultant seeks to turn broad, aspirational goals into concrete, timebound policy, or funding decisionsThe aim is to equip advocates to achieve real, achievable, and sustainable change by providing them with the tools and strategies to effectively navigate the advocacy process.SMART advocacy helps advocates to: Nurture Relationships with Stakeholders, Increase Public Awareness, Secure Funding for the Organization, Boost Participation in Events and Campaigns, Strengthen Internal Communication, Enhance Media Coverage, Develop Digital Advocacy Skills, Coordinate and Leverage Partnerships, Strengthen Network of Advocates, Educate and Inform Constituents, Create Narratives for Systemic Change, and Foster Culture of Civic Engagement

About Jhpiego

Jhpiego is a nonprofit global leader in the creation and delivery of transformative health care solutions for the developing world. In partnership with national governments, health experts and local communities, we build health providers’ skills, and develop systems that save lives now and guarantee healthier futures for women and their families. Our aim is revolutionizing health care for the planet’s most disadvantaged people.

Jhpiego, a Johns Hopkins University Affiliate, translates decades of program experience and in-depth technical knowledge into moments of care that can mean the difference between life and death for women and families.
